Staircase designs are one of the important elements of architecture, which guides the path to go vertically. They allow users to travel vertically from a certain height distance to another, acting as a vertical bridge, an easy innovation of history, probably more than 6000 BCE. History has shown a constantly changing trend in the design and evolution of stairs (w.r.t. materials, design, the addition of elements, structure) with every architectural period 9 from ancient civilization to the 21st century. 

In today’s world, we often see synonyms of the stairs in more advanced ways such as Lifts, elevators, stairlifts, ladders, escalators, walkways, and ramps, which function similarly to the stairs.

Various parts of the Staircase

Step

A step comprises two parts of the staircase- Riser and Tread.

Riser

The Vertical element that adds height to the tread is known as a riser. Closed staircases have risers in various styles and materials, whereas Open stairs do not have risers, so they are known as open-tread staircases. The number of Risers is calculated by dividing the floor-to-floor height by the height of 1 Riser.

According to the National Building Code of India, Chapter 3, under the staircase provision, the maximum riser height shall be 150 mm irrespective of the building type. There should be a maximum of 12 risers in a single flight.

Tread

The horizontal element, i.e. the base of the staircase on which the user steps in to move vertically is known as a tread. All staircases have treads irrespective of the width and thickness. The number of Treads is always one less than the number of Risers. According to the National Building Code of India, the minimum tread should not exceed 250 mm.

Landing

The wide step or platform provides a resting space or indicates a change in the direction of the staircase. The landing should be placed after every 12 risers in a flight.

Flight

A vertical series of steps bridging between two levels of a structure.

Nosing

The extended edge part of the tread is known as nosing. It is used to protect from injury as most of the walking activity takes place on the tread. The most commonly used materials for nosing are marble, vinyl, aluminium, wood, etc.

Handrail

A handrail is a rail placed right above the pitch to hold and support the user. It is also termed a bannister. Every staircase set has a handrail as one of the components. It commonly ranges between 80 and 90 cm. For the elderly or physically abled- a different railing is provided on the left side of the stair directly attached to the wall. The handrail is fixed on balustrades which supports to stand erect. Newel Post

The vertical support column placed at the beginning and the end of the handrail provides support to both the handrail and balustrades. It is generally 9×9 cm.

Floating Staircases

These staircases tend to determine the idea that treads are in the air or floating in a particular direction, this appears without support obstructing the natural view. These minimalistic trending staircases in a house offer unobstructed views. The design not only avails in linear geometry but also has proofs in curves.

Cantilever Staircases

The staircases where tread appears to be in the air as if in the air and without any support. The support is hidden in minimalistic ways. The difference between the floating staircase and the cantilever staircase is there is hidden structural support in these staircases. The tension is visually strong.

Glass Railings

For a sleek and contemporary interior style, glass railings are a perfect choice. A frameless glass in glass railings is a popular choice. Tempered clear glass, colourful glasses, black glass, textured glass, etc. are some of the glasses used in the glass grills. These glass railings are fixed through metal clips, an EPDM gasket is also provided for protection from vibration and insulation.

Cable Railings

Cable railings are widely used in the exterior of commercial and pool areas. These railings are corrosion-resistant and weather resistant which makes them the best option to use near water-side areas such as pools, etc. Generally, stainless steel is used as cables in staircases or general railings. 

These railings offer unobstructed views because cables are less known hurdles. Their strength and durability depend on the type of material, size, and how close the cables and posts are held together.

Tiles are an important aspect of staircase design. The appropriate choice of tiles can elevate the aesthetic and safety of a staircase. The selection of tiles may vary depending on the interior mood board, the safety, and durability of the building, and the cost.

These tiles are best suited for interiors. Ceramic patterned tiles bring the aesthetic and cultural aspect of the staircase. These are durable, water-resistant, and easy to clean and maintain.

Quarry tiles are a prominent choice, as they look similar to terracotta tiles and provide a natural look. These tiles are extremely durable, quite affordable, and long-lasting.
